Transaction 63eedc772e6cad6f7a69a8a9f59c455ba5518feef060a74a80aad9170b980ee5
1 Input
2 Outputs
- 63eedc772e6cad6f7a69a8a9f59c455ba5518feef060a74a80aad9170b980ee5:0
- 63eedc772e6cad6f7a69a8a9f59c455ba5518feef060a74a80aad9170b980ee5:1
value 149416
address 36PEyr6kWwcXN9qVhs3iW5qujNoxDsWmNR
value 51847661
address 1PcB1RbvjgAnJBMEwpC88RNew3W5chF4bk